		<description>I would still cite Junior as the best player of his generation and still in the discussion of all-time great outfielders, primarily because he was the one star whose name never, ever was dirtied with steroid accusations. Had Barry not ruined his legacy, he would have still been one the best three players ever, but the minute he went Big Mac on us and turned into the Incredible Hulk, he handed the title over to Griff by disqualification.

Great look at my all-time favourite slugger (Back to back 56 HR seasons without the crank...unreal)</description>
